权限与安全规范前置(约300字) 1.1 权限验证机制
图片来源于网络,如有侵权联系删除
- 实施多层级权限管控体系,要求重启操作必须经过双人授权确认(RBAC模型)
- 使用密钥对操作进行数字签名(GPG/SSH Agent)
- 记录操作日志至syslog服务器,满足GDPR合规要求
2 环境隔离策略
- 创建专用操作终端(禁用图形界面)
- 启用SELinux强制访问控制(配置策略模块)
- 实施网络流量白名单(仅允许特定IP段操作)
3 时间窗口控制
- 设定每日维护时段(如UTC+8 02:00-04:00)
- 关联服务器负载监控(Prometheus+Zabbix)
- 自动触发预检流程(提前30分钟邮件通知)
全链路状态诊断(约400字) 2.1 服务拓扑可视化
- 使用Consul/Fluentd构建服务发现系统
- 实时监控各组件健康状态(HTTP API健康检查)
- 检测依赖服务可用性(DNS查询+TCP握手)
2 数据一致性校验
- 执行CMS数据库自动校验(CheckDB模式)
- 检查文件系统配额( quota -v)
- 验证缓存一致性(Redis/Memcached)
3 性能基准测试
- 模拟3000+并发用户压力测试(Locust)
- 执行数据库事务回滚测试(事务日志验证)
- 检测存储IOPS性能曲线(iostat监控)
分级重启操作规范(约500字) 3.1 普通服务重启流程
- Nginx架构:优雅关闭(nginx -s stop)→ 清理缓存 → 启动服务
- Java应用:jstack导出堆内存 → 阶梯式线程降级 → 持续监控GC日志
- PHP服务:检查文件权限(chown/fperm)→ 清理临时目录 → 重启守护进程
2 容器化部署场景
- Docker集群:编写重启脚本(docker service restart)+ 滚动更新策略
- Kubernetes环境:执行滚动重启(kubectl rollout restart)+ Liveness探针配置
- Serverless架构:触发函数热更新(AWS Lambda自定义层)
3 硬件级操作规范
- 服务器硬件重启:通过IPMI/iLO远程控制
- 存储阵列重构:执行在线重建(ZFS/MDadm)
- 网络设备重载:配置BGP重传策略(BGP Keepalive)
灾备与快速恢复(约400字) 4.1 智能备份系统
- 自动化分层备份策略:
- 数据库:时间序列备份(Barman)+增量备份
- 系统卷:ZFS快照+rsync增量
- 配置文件:Ansible Playbook版本控制
2 弹性恢复机制
图片来源于网络,如有侵权联系删除
- 构建多活架构(Active-Standby模式)
- 设计自动故障切换流程(Keepalived+VRRP)
- 部署灰度发布系统(特征开关+流量切分)
3 应急恢复演练
- 定期执行Chaos Engineering测试
- 模拟核心服务宕机演练(全链路压测)
- 建立RTO<15分钟恢复预案
智能监控与预警(约300字) 5.1 基础设施监控
- 实时监控CPU/Memory/Disk使用率(CAdvisor)
- 网络流量异常检测(Suricata规则)
- 服务依赖拓扑监控(ServiceGraph)
2 智能预警系统
- 构建异常检测模型(孤立森林算法)
- 预警分级机制(Warning/Alert/Crisis)
- 自动化响应流程(Slack+钉钉多通道通知)
3 历史数据分析
- 建立故障知识图谱(Neo4j存储)
- 智能根因分析(APM+日志关联分析)
- 预测性维护模型(LSTM时间序列预测)
安全审计与合规(约200字) 6.1 操作审计追踪
- 完整记录操作日志(syslog+ELK)
- 实施操作回滚机制(Etcd操作记录)
- 通过审计报告生成(Logstash+PDF)
2 合规性检查
- GDPR数据保护日志
- ISO27001访问控制审计
- 等保2.0三级认证记录
3 合规性培训
- 每季度开展安全操作培训
- 建立操作认证体系(CCSP认证)
- 实施操作行为分析(UEBA)
本方案通过构建"预防-检测-响应-恢复"的完整闭环体系,结合自动化运维工具链和智能分析平台,将CMS系统重启成功率提升至99.99%,平均恢复时间(MTTR)控制在8分钟以内,特别设计的分级操作规范和智能监控体系,有效避免了传统运维中常见的误操作风险,在保障系统稳定运行的同时,显著提升了运维效率,实际应用案例表明,该方案可使年度系统停机时间减少92%,运维成本降低40%,为现代化企业级应用系统运维提供了可复用的最佳实践模板。
标签: #中心服务器里cms怎么重启
评论列表